Appearance quality of tyres
1 Scope
This Standard specifies the requirements for the appearance quality of tyres.
This Standard applies to the pneumatic tyres of trucks, cars, construction machinery,
industrial vehicles, agriculture and motorcycle, solid tyres of pneumatic tire rims, cove tyre
and the flap of pressed-on solid tyres.
2 Normative references
The articles contained in the following documents have become part of this document
when they are quoted herein. For the dated documents so quoted, all the modifications
(Including all corrections) or revisions made thereafter shall be applicable to this
document.
GB/T 6326 Tyre terms and definitions
3 Terms and definitions
The terms and definitions defined in GB/T 6326 apply to this Standard.
4 Requirements
4.1 The appearance quality of tyre shall comply with provisions in table 1 to table 3; the
flap shall comply with provisions in table 4.
4.2 The appearance quality of tyre is allowed to be re-evaluated after its defects have
been rectified and repaired.

Note.
“Special giant” refers to the pneumatic tire with a rim with nominal diameter of 33 in and the above, and nominal section width of 24 in and the above.
“Giant” refers to the pneumatic tire with nominal section width of 18 in and the above that does not meet the conditions referred in the “special giant”.
“Big” refers to the pneumatic tire with nominal section width below 18 in and above 10 in.
“Medium” refers to the non-limousine tyre with nominal section width below 10 in, excluding the pneumatic tire with rim diameter of 12 in and the below.
“Small” refers to limousine tires and the car tires with nominal rim diameter of 12 in and the below.
Table 2 Tyre of motorcycles
No. Defects name Allowable range
1 Crown channelling and dislocation of plastic edge and die orifice
Depth or thickness ≤1.0 mm and the plastic edge height
≤3.0 mm
2 Patten glue starvation or rounded pattern
Depth ≤2.0 mm and the accumulative length ≤ 1/4 of the
circumstance
3 Cracks, cold-lay and glue starvation beside the tyre
Crack. not allowed
Cold-lay and glue starvation. depth ≤ 40% of the plastic
thickness beside the tyre and the length at one location
≤ 50 mm; the that at the other side shall not exceed
three locations.
4 Border break of the bread heel The thickness of that sandwiched with cord edge ≤3.0 mm
5 The thin seam of the first layer of the cord Depth ≤ 3.0 mm and the number of it ≤ 8
The impression of the impurities,
bubble impression or damage on the
thread cap and the tyre side
The depth at thread cap ≤ 20% of the depth of the
pattern ditch
The depth at beside the tyre ≤ 40% of the plastic
thickness of the tire
The diameter of bubble impression ≤ 6.0 mm
All of them shall not exceed two locations (the seal layer
of the tyre without inner tyre shall not have bubbles)
7 Uneven of the tire bead The depth or the height ≤2.0 mm and there is no hard bending in steel ring.
8 Tire bead varying in width
The ratio value between the width difference and the
wide one of tire bead ≤ 30% and the width of the narrow
tyre bead ≥ 70% of the designed width of the tyre bead.
For tyre without inner tyre. The ratio value between the
width difference and the wide one of tire bead ≤ 15%
and the width of the narrow tyre bead ≥ 85% of the
designed width of the tyre bead.
9 Rounded bead toe
The bead toe shall not exceed the ditch and become
limp; the length ≤ 1/3 of the circumstance of the tyre
bead
10 Uneven and impressions of pressed material in tyre
The depth ≤ 1.0 mm and the area ≤ 800 mm2 and the
cross-country tread pattern is allowed to have patterns.
